################################################################################
# getPreds.R
# The purpose of this function is to get the predictions and standard
# errors from a glmssn.predict object. For observed sites, the predictions represent
# the cross-validation predictions and associated standard errors.
################################################################################
getPreds <- function(x,pred.type="cv") {
if(pred.type == "cv") {
pred.mat <- CrossValidationSSN(x)
} else if(pred.type == "pred") {
if (length(x$ssn.object@predpoints@ID) == 0) {
stop("no prediction points exist in glmssn.predict object") }
else if (length(x$ssn.object@predpoints@ID) == 1){
predpointsID <- x$arg$predpoints
slot.i <- 1 }
else {
for (i in 1:length(x$ssn.object@predpoints@ID)){
if (x$args$predpointsID == x$ssn.object@predpoints@ID[[i]]) {
predpointsID <- x$ssn.object@predpoints@ID[[i]]
slot.i <- i
}
}}
pred.name <- x$args$zcol
predSE.name <- paste(pred.name, ".predSE", sep = "")
predSE.name2<- paste(pred.name, "PredSE", sep = "")
pred.mat <- cbind(x$ssn.object@predpoints@SSNPoints[[slot.i]]@point.data[,"pid"],
x$ssn.object@predpoints@SSNPoints[[slot.i]]@point.data[,pred.name],
x$ssn.object@predpoints@SSNPoints[[slot.i]]@point.data[,predSE.name])
colnames(pred.mat) <- c("pid", pred.name, predSE.name2)
} else {
stop("invalid prediction type")
}
return(pred.mat)
}
